An active email-driven AitM phishing campaign is hijacking Microsoft 365 accounts and exposing payroll and HR mailboxes across multiple sectors. The operation has targeted hundreds of organizations in the U.S., Canada, and Europe, making the credential theft and session hijacking effort broad enough to affect many enterprises at once.

    Email-driven AitM phishing campaign hijacks Microsoft 365 accounts

    Initial Disclosure

    An active email-driven adversary-in-the-middle phishing campaign is hijacking Microsoft 365 accounts to identify payroll and HR personnel and collect related mailbox data, with hundreds of organizations targeted across the U.S., Canada, and Europe. The activity uses residential proxies and proxied Microsoft authentication to blend malicious sign-ins into ordinary consumer traffic.
